Sunil Thapa's funeral at Pashupati Aryaghat

Main News Image

Kathmandu. Senior actor Sunil Thapa was cremated at Pashupati Aryaghat on Tuesday. He was cremated according to Hindu tradition in the presence of family members, relatives, friends and well-wishers on Sunday. The funeral at Aryaghat was attended by personalities from various fields and prayed for the eternal peace of the departed soul. During the funeral, the family looked emotional and everyone present paid their respects.

Condolences have been expressed from various quarters over the death of Thapa. Many have also expressed their condolences to the bereaved family through social media. Thapa's death has left his family, relatives and acquaintances deeply saddened. Thapa passed away last Saturday due to a heart attack.
